Detailed Job Description:

We are seeking an experienced IAM Architect to lead global Identity & Access Management operations and drive enterprise-wide IAM strategy.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Oversee a global team of IAM engineers, ensuring stability, availability, and performance of IAM platforms across multiple regions.
  • Provide technical leadership for IAM initiatives, including platform upgrades, migrations, and large-scale implementations.
  • Lead the design, implementation, and migration of IAM platforms (Ping / ForgeRock / Microsoft Entra ID).
  • Architect IAM integrations across cloud and on-prem environments, including Azure Kubernetes Services (AKS).
  • Enhance IAM platform resiliency, scalability, and operational performance.
  • Ensure compliance with internal security policies, audit requirements, and industry best practices.
  • Work closely with Risk, Audit, and Governance teams to maintain security standards.
  • Lead penetration testing, auditing, and risk governance activities for IAM and other cybersecurity initiatives.
  • Collaborate with IT Engineering, Enterprise Architecture, and vendor teams to optimize costs, enhance security, and improve operational efficiency.
  • Drive successful outcomes across multiple stakeholders through effective communication and coordination.
  • Manage both project-based and operational-support IAM teams.
  • Oversee ITIL processes including Change, Release, Problem, Incident, Configuration, Asset, and Application Management.
  • Ensure documentation accuracy, quality delivery, and continuous process improvement.
  • Mentor, coach, and develop IAM engineers, fostering a high-performance and skill-building culture.

Must-Have Skills:

  • 10+ years of hands-on experience in Identity & Access Management and Cybersecurity.
  • Strong background in architecting, deploying, and managing IAM solutions at enterprise scale.
  • Mandatory experience with Ping and/or ForgeRock IAM platforms.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Entra ID and hybrid cloud IAM integrations.
  • Experience implementing IAM solutions in Azure Kubernetes Services (AKS) or similar cloud-native environments.
  • Strong understanding of identity federation, SSO, MFA, access governance, and lifecycle management.
  • Proven experience leading large, global, cross-functional teams for end-to-end delivery.
  • Ability to manage multiple high-priority initiatives in fast-paced, high-pressure environments.
  • Experience working in Operations/Run roles with strong knowledge of ITIL processes.
